How much does it cost to rent a home in Liberty Triangle?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Liberty Triangle 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,560 | $1,295 | $2,000 |
| Liberty Triangle 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,860 | $1,300 | $2,995 |
| Liberty Triangle 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,301 | $1,800 | $4,000 |
| Liberty Triangle 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,690 | $2,400 | $3,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Liberty Triangle
What type of rentals are currently available in Liberty Triangle?
There are currently 36 Apartments for Rent in Liberty Triangle, FL with pricing that ranges from $792 to $4,091. There are also 109 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Liberty Triangle ranging from $1,295 to $4,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Liberty Triangle?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Liberty Triangle ranges from $1,295 to $4,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,102.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Liberty Triangle?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Liberty Triangle range from $1,349 to $4,091,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,300 to $2,995.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,800 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,249.
